They prevent leaks and maintain the integrity of the combustion process, which involves extreme temperatures.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>When an engine\u00ad is running, the temperature\u00ad at various locations can be between 80\u00b0C to 120\u00b0C. But the combustion chambers whe\u00adre the fuel burns can re\u00adach about 2500\u00b0C. The exhaust gasses le\u00adaving the engine can be\u00ad over 1000\u00b0C. These e\u00adxtreme heat le\u00advels put a lot of stress on engine\u00ad parts. However, the high te\u00admperatures are an unavoidable part of the exothermic combustion process native to the <\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>functioning of an ICE.Properly functioning <strong>gaskets for cars<\/strong> are essential to prevent catastrophic engine failures. Their primary purpose is to prevent leakage of fluids, gasses and the air\/fuel mixture while also preventing contaminants from entering into internal parts of the engines where they can cause harm. This sealing activity is essential for maintaining the integrity of the combustion process and ensuring the proper performance of the engines.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>The head gasket, which seals cylinders where combustion takes place, has to face the highest pressure and temperature levels amongst all <strong><a href=\"https:\/\/www.garimaglobal.com\/engine-gaskets-and-seals\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\">gaskets in an engine<\/a><\/strong>. In a petrol engine, this can be up to 1000 psi, but in the case of a diesel engine, it may rise beyond 2700 psi while temperatures could reach 2500\u00b0F (1371\u00b0C)<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>The head gaske\u00adt prevents leakage\u00ad of the compressed air-fue\u00adl mixture. This helps maintain the e\u00adngine&#8217;s compression ratio. Gas (petrol) or spark ignition engine\u00ads typically have a compression ratio of 8:1 to 12:1. Diese\u00adl or compression ignition engines have a highe\u00adr compression ratio of 14:1 to 25:1. Higher compression in diese\u00adls increases combustion pressure\u00ads and temperatures. So, the\u00ad head gasket nee\u00adds superior sealing.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Other gaske\u00adts seal parts like intake\/e\u00adxhaust manifolds for proper air\/exhaust flow. They also use valve covers and oil pans to preve\u00adnt oil leaks. Each gasket is designed for the specific working\u00ad conditions at its location. Together, they form the\u00ad engine&#8217;s sealing syste\u00adm.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Importance of Gaskets in Engine Operation<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Gaskets are essential for the effective performance and durability of an engine. These components are responsible for several critical functions in the operation of the engine and ensure that it works reliably under extreme conditions.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<div class=\"wp-block-columns is-layout-flex wp-container-core-columns-is-layout-9d6595d7 wp-block-columns-is-layout-flex\">\n<div class=\"wp-block-column is-layout-flow wp-block-column-is-layout-flow\" style=\"flex-basis:100%\">\n<div class=\"wp-block-group\"><div class=\"wp-block-group__inner-container is-layout-constrained wp-block-group-is-layout-constrained\">\n<div class=\"wp-block-group\"><div class=\"wp-block-group__inner-container is-layout-constrained wp-block-group-is-layout-constrained\">\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Maintaining Combustion Integrity<\/strong> <br><p>The head gasket, among other gaskets in an engine, is important in sealing off the combustion chambers. This is necessary to prevent compressed air-fuel mixture from leaking out as well as combustion gasses getting into the atmosphere. It helps in maintaining the designed compression ratio and efficiency of combustion within the engine.<\/p><\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Preventing Fluid Mixing<\/strong> <p>Gaskets seal such parts as <strong><a href=\"https:\/\/www.garimaglobal.com\/cylinder-heads\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">cylinder head<\/a><\/strong>, oil pan, water jackets, etc., thus preventing engine oil from mixing with coolant or any other fluid entering different sections where they would cause serious damage leading to breakdown.<\/p><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<\/div><\/div>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Withstanding Extreme Temperatures<\/strong><br><p>During operation, heat is generated due to combustion within the engine. In diesel engines, for instance, the temperatures can rise to 2,500\u00b0F (1,371\u00b0C). <strong>Gaskets for car engines<\/strong> are able to withstand such high temperatures while still maintaining their sealing capabilities. Many solid rubber gaskets are capable of operating at around 248\u00b0F (120\u00b0C), but more advanced materials like silicone, VITON rubbers, compressed non-asbestos fibers (CNAFs), etc., are used for higher temperature ranges going up to 842\u00b0F (450\u00b0C). Flexible rubbers such as high-temperature silicone have continuous working limits of 572\u00b0F (300\u00b0C), while others made from ceramic, mica, clay-based elements, etc., function between 932\u00b0F (500\u00b0C) and 2,192\u00b0F (1,200\u00b0C).<\/p><\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Enabling Proper Fluid Flow<\/strong>\n<p>Intake and exhaust manifold gaskets help direct air, fuel and exhaust gasses along their designated paths, thereby ensuring efficient operation.<\/p>\n<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<\/div><\/div>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ong><strong><strong><strong><strong><strong>What Happens When Gasket Fails<\/strong><\/strong><\/strong><\/strong><\/strong><\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>When an engine<strong> gasket <\/strong>fails, it can lead to various issues, depending on the system and the gasket&#8217;s location. Here are some of the main effects: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ong><strong>Leak<\/strong><\/strong><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>Fluids or gasses escape from their designated areas, causing operational issues. This can lead to spills and environmental hazards<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Pressure Loss<\/strong><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>Whe\u00adn pressure drops, ICE systems do not work as we\u00adll. This lower pressure make\u00ads things less efficient and may cause\u00ad shutdowns.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Contamination<\/strong><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>Fluids or gasses mix when they shouldn&#8217;t, causing damage. This can lead to engine failures and costly repairs.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Overheating<\/strong><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>Engines overheat after losing their coolants through leaks, thus causing potential damage; this might lead to warping, seizing or cracking some parts of the engine block.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Reduced Performance<\/strong><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>Leaks or pressure loss reduce machinery or engine efficiency. This leads to increased operational costs and downtime.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Mechanical Damage<\/strong><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>Prolonged gasket failure can severely damage components. Repairs or replacements become necessary, increasing costs.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Preventive Measures and Maintenance Tips<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Proactive maintenance prolongs the lifespan of seals and <strong>gaskets in an engine<\/strong>, prevents damage, and avoids costly repairs. How do gaskets withstand high temperatures and pressures within the engine?<\/strong><\/strong> <p class=\"schema-faq-answer\">Engines work with ve\u00adry hot temperatures and high pre\u00adssures. Special gaskets are\u00ad used to handle these\u00ad tough conditions. Natural rubber gaskets cannot handle e\u00adxtreme heat as the\u00ady may catch fire, shrink, melt, or become\u00ad misshapen. For temperature\u00ads over 500\u2070C, gaskets made of mate\u00adrials like graphite or mica work bette\u00adr. These materials are\u00ad stiff and do not compress easily, which helps cre\u00adate a tight seal in extre\u00adme heat. Spiral wound gaskets are\u00ad also effective, e\u00adspecially with high pressure. The\u00ady have a spiral metal ring with graphite or othe\u00adr fillers inside. There\u00ad is also an outer metal ring. When compre\u00adssed, these rings seal tightly. To prevent oxidation above 600\u2070C, the\u00adrmiculite is used as a filler in spiral wound gaske\u00adts. Vermiculite can compress but doe\u00ads not react with oxygen at ultra-high temps.<\/p> <\/div> <\/div>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\"><\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\"><\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p><\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>Gaskets are crucial components in automotive engines, forming essential seals between mating surfaces.
